The city of Boynton Beach enjoys a privileged location in Palm Beach County along Florida’s Gold Coast. Other Gold Coast destinations include the likes of Fort Lauderdale, Boca Raton, Palm Beach, and Miami. In this part of the state, Atlantic Ocean beaches nearly meet the Everglades, providing an ideal backdrop for Florida vacations. In Boynton Beach itself, the beautiful beaches have long been the main draw. Redevelopment of the downtown area and the marina have brought a whole new interest to Boynton Beach vacations.

When Boynton Beach visitors aren’t relaxing on the sand or enjoying Everglades tours, they can take in some of the city’s cultural attractions. At 306 S.E. First Avenue, the Andrews Home offers insight into the city’s history. The oldest home in town, it dates back to 1901 and displays interesting historical items that were found in the immediate area. For families, the Schoolhouse Children’s Museum at 129 East Ocean Avenue has hands-on exhibits that can add enjoyable depth to the itinerary. Another Boynton Beach Florida attraction worth noting is the Lofthus shipwreck. This underwater archaeological preserve is a favorite among the area scuba diving crowd.
